  • School Elections 2020

    SAMPLE BALLOT

    Ballots will be mailed April 20, 2020

    Ballots must be received at the Cascade County Elections Office, 325 2nd Ave North #100 by Tuesday, May 5, 2020 at 8:00 pm.

    If you choose not to mail your ballot, collection sites on Election Day, May 5, 2020 include:
    Exhibition Hall at the Fairgrounds from 7:00 am - 8:00 pm and the Cascade County Elections Office, 325 2nd Ave North #100, from 7:00 am - 8:00 pm

    Voter Registration Cards

    • Voter registration cards can be picked up at the Cascade County Elections Office, 325 2nd Ave North #100 from 7:00 am - 5:00 pm
    • Voter registration cards can be picked up at the Great Falls Public Schools District Offices Building, 1100 4th Street South (main door) from 8:00 am - 5:00 pm
    • Voter registration cards must be completed and received at the Cascade County Elections Office by Monday, April 6, 2020

    2020 Elementary Operational Levy Information

    Trustee Resolution Setting Mill Levy Amount Elementary General Fund
    The Board approved the Resolution setting the mill levy amounts for the Elementary General Fund Budget Levy at $1,750,000, on March 9, 2020, at a Regular Meeting of the Board of Trustees.  The maximum which may be levied in the Elementary District is $1,785,295.70.

    How to file: School District Trustee Filing Timeline

    There are currently three, three-year terms on the District School Board that are expiring. Any individuals who are interested in running must file a DECLARATION OF INTENT AND OATH OF CANDIDACY FOR TRUSTEE CANDIDATES with the County Elections Office. This office is located at 325 2nd Ave North, Great Falls. The filing date to do this is December 12, 2019 through March 26, 2020. Candidates must report campaign expenditures to the Montana Commissioner of Political Practices.

    The Board approved the Resolution Calling for a School Election to be held on May 5, 2020, at the Regular Meeting of the Board of Trustees on January 27, 2020.  The purpose of the election is to elect three (3) trustees each for a three-year term.  Approval of additional levies to operate and maintain the General Fund for FY 2020 may also be requested.  If it is later determined that any portion of the election is not required, the Board of Trustees authorizes Brian Patrick, election administrator, to cancel that portion of the election in accordance with 13-1-304, MCA and 20-3-313, MCA.
